Irene Sánchez is a scholar working on Ophthalmology, Radiology, Nuclear Medicine and Imaging and Epidemiology. According to data from OpenAlex, Irene Sánchez has authored 28 papers receiving a total of 546 indexed citations (citations by other indexed papers that have themselves been cited), including 17 papers in Ophthalmology, 14 papers in Radiology, Nuclear Medicine and Imaging and 10 papers in Epidemiology. Recurrent topics in Irene Sánchez's work include Glaucoma and retinal disorders (13 papers), Corneal surgery and disorders (12 papers) and Ophthalmology and Visual Impairment Studies (10 papers). Irene Sánchez is often cited by papers focused on Glaucoma and retinal disorders (13 papers), Corneal surgery and disorders (12 papers) and Ophthalmology and Visual Impairment Studies (10 papers). Irene Sánchez collaborates with scholars based in Spain, United Kingdom and United States. Irene Sánchez's co-authors include Raúl Martín, Fernando Ussa, Ivan Fernandez‐Bueno, Vicente Ferreira, Ricardo López, Juan Cacho, Sara Ortiz-Toquero, Ana Moya, Jordi Aguiló and V. N. Laukhin and has published in prestigious journals such as Food Chemistry, Investigative Ophthalmology & Visual Science and Sensors and Actuators A Physical.
